## 4.2.0 — Changed defaults

The Pelicore barcode scanner integration now defaults to continuous-scan mode instead of single-shot, and the decode timeout dropped from 5s to 2s. Batch uploads flush every 30 scans rather than 100. If warehouse handhelds start dropping reads overnight, revert via the override file. The integration currently starts with the following configuration values.

service settings:
[casax]
port = 6379
team = rusir
host = casax.zemvarhq.corp
region = outer-4
access_code = ac_9808ce
timeout_ms = 1500

Context for reviewers: the Quillbend tax-rate lookup cache sits in front of the jurisdiction service and holds rates for 24 hours. Stale entries are tolerated; incorrect ones are not, so pay close attention to any change touching invalidation keys. Local testing requires the cache's env file, where the upstream service credential must appear on the line directly after this one.

vault entry, kafog-yahop: COURIER_KEY8=0faa53ae

Before approving changes to the Givewell... sorry, the **Grateleaf** receipt mailer, please understand the signing flow. Each donation receipt PDF is stamped by the render worker, then the batch manifest is signed so the Hollis Foundation's audit tooling can verify nothing was altered between generation and dispatch. Reviewers should confirm that any code touching the manifest builder preserves canonical field ordering, since the signature covers the serialized form byte-for-byte. For local verification runs, use the signing key provided below.

deploy key for kajof-fajop: bky6_gDHw9Q